Mobile Streaming Turns Every Day into Game Day
Whether you’re a dedicated fan or the tech expert behind the scenes, you know how frustrating it can be to plan your day around game start times—or settle for delayed updates after the action ends. Now, platforms like MLB.TV and team-specific direct-to-consumer services change all that. Fans can watch every out-of-market major and minor league game live or on-demand, in sharp HD quality, using phones, tablets, or nearly any device at hand. This lets you stay caught up on the season even while running errands or attending your child’s school event. And it’s not just limited to the majors; Minor League Baseball streaming is also available, highlighting future stars. Bonus offers from some cellular providers even include free MLB.TV access, lowering barriers for busy fans who want full control over their game-day experience.
Every moment counts—features like picture-in-picture viewing and multiview functionality let you keep tabs on several games simultaneously. This makes it easy to track fantasy stats, follow rival teams, or watch key big-league debuts without interrupting your daily routine. If you miss a pitch, rewinding or catching highlights right through the official app is a breeze—even when you’re on the move.
Real-Time Alerts & Social: Building Community Anywhere
You can’t always be glued to a screen, no matter how much you want to be—but you can still stay deeply connected to all the excitement. Today’s OTT apps and MLB’s own platforms deliver lightning-quick push notifications, including game start alerts, breaking highlights, walk-offs, and stat updates—customized to your preferences. On compatible devices, live scores and ongoing plays appear directly on your lock screen, so you stay in the know without even unlocking your phone, no matter where you are.
The feeling of being part of a live community doesn’t disappear because you’re remote. Social features built into apps enable instant reactions, conversations, and celebrations with fellow fans as the games unfold. It recreates the buzz of being at the ballpark, wherever you might be. Whenever something unforgettable happens—a thrilling comeback, an ejection, an upset—your chat groups or baseball forums come alive, making sure you never have to cheer alone on the go.
Flexible Access: Taking the Game Beyond Borders
Accessibility is no longer one-size-fits-all. Direct-to-consumer digital subscriptions offer monthly or yearly plans, so fans decide how, when, and how much they want to follow the action. Teams increasingly offer “geography-blind” streaming, letting international followers bypass most blackout restrictions and join the excitement regardless of their location worldwide. For casual viewers, free Game of the Day options frequently appear, enticing new fans to jump in.
